Why are long claws common?

Getting into the habit of trimming your dog’s claws regularly can be difficult, especially if they don’t enjoy having their paws touched or claws clipped. To make matters worse, many owners are reluctant to clip their dog’s claws because they’re concerned that they might cut into the quick (a blood supply that lies part-way along the middle of claw). Despite these challenges, regularly caring for your dog’s claws is of the utmost importance and will keep their paws healthy and pain free.

Do Grinding A Dog’s Nails Hurt Them?

Overall, no. One of the main reasons why dog owners switch to grinder form traditional scissors clipping is because they can’t hurt their dog.

To grind dog’s nails you have to put the rotary tool directly onto the dog’s nails. This tool is prone to heat after prolonged use, so it’s recommended that you only hold it on your dog’s nail for a second or two at a time. You will see how you can get dog’s nails much shorter than with clippers. The great thing about grinding is that you are removing only small bits of the nail at a time. Therefore, it’s easy to watch your progress and not to worry about cutting into the quick.

In order to have safe and peacefully grinding it’s important to introduce your dog or cat to this technique and tool properly. Make sure that you take your time and use plenty of love,  encouragement and treats.
